Job Summary: The Program Manager provides oversight and planning for the development, implementation, and delivery of a program(s).

Additional Department Summary: We are seeking a motivated individual to continue and expand the education and outreach efforts of the Translational Research for Injury Prevention (TRIP) Laboratory at the University of Alabama Institute for Social Science Research.

The primary goals of this position are: 1) To serve as the lead field representative in community and school outreach programs for the TRIP Lab, 2) To direct the operations of all community outreach events, 3) To independently design, develop, and administer program content, and 4) To provide oversight of students/staff engaged in carrying out the program activities.

Required Department Minimum Qualifications: MA, MS, or MPH -OR- BA, BS + 2 years’ experience.

Educational background in Psychology, Public Health, Communications, Education, Counseling, Public Relations, or related field.

Must have valid U.S. driver’s license. Must be at least 19 years of age at time of hire and have an acceptable Motor Vehicle Report that is in compliance with University policies. Applicants under the age of 21 will have some driving restrictions.

Skills and Knowledge: Intrinsic motivation to work with high school students. Seeking an outgoing, energetic, positive, focused, and organized individual. Refined verbal and written communication skills. Excellent interpersonal skills. Excellent public speaker. Basic desktop computing skills. Ability to work with diverse groups and adolescents. Prior leadership experience or involvement in community outreach (volunteer or paid) is preferred.
